Marble Tile Repair in Overland Park, KS
Marble tile repair services focus on restoring the beauty and functionality of marble surfaces in residential properties. This includes fixing cracks, chips, and scratches, as well as addressing issues like staining, discoloration, or surface dullness. Projects often involve repairing damaged areas in flooring, countertops, or backsplashes to help maintain the aesthetic appeal and longevity of marble installations. Property owners typically want to understand the scope of repairs needed, the materials used, and how repairs can blend seamlessly with existing marble surfaces.
Before requesting marble tile repair, homeowners should assess the extent of damage and consider whether the repairs will match the original marble’s color and texture. It’s also helpful to inquire about the repair process, including any necessary surface preparation or sealing to prevent future issues. Clear communication about the specific problems, such as cracking or staining, can ensure that the repair process addresses all concerns and results in a durable, attractive finish.

Marble Tile Repair Questions
What types of damage can be repaired in marble tiles? Common issues like cracks, chips, stains, and surface scratches can typically be restored to improve appearance and functionality.
Is marble tile repair suitable for all areas of a property? Marble repairs are often performed in kitchens, bathrooms, entryways, and other high-traffic or visible areas.
What causes damage to marble tiles? Damage can result from impacts, heavy foot traffic, spills, or improper cleaning techniques over time.
How can I tell if my marble tile needs repair? Visible cracks, discoloration, or surface dullness are signs that repair or restoration may be needed.
